Understanding the UPS Claim Form

The UPS claim form is a crucial document used by customers to report issues related to lost, damaged, or delayed shipments. This form allows individuals and businesses to formally request compensation for their losses. It is essential to understand the specific circumstances under which a claim can be filed, as well as the types of coverage provided by UPS. Familiarizing yourself with the details of this form can help streamline the claims process and ensure that you meet all necessary requirements.

Steps to Complete the UPS Claim Form

Filling out the UPS claim form requires careful attention to detail. Here are the steps to ensure you complete the form correctly:

  • Gather all relevant information including tracking numbers, shipment details, and evidence of the issue (such as photos of damaged items).
  • Access the UPS claim form through the UPS website or customer service.
  • Fill in your contact information accurately, as this will be used for correspondence regarding your claim.
  • Provide detailed information about the shipment, including the contents, value, and the nature of the claim (lost, damaged, etc.).
  • Attach any supporting documents that validate your claim, such as receipts or photographs.
  • Review the completed form for accuracy before submission.

Required Documents for Filing a Claim

When submitting a UPS claim, certain documents are necessary to support your request. These typically include:

  • The completed UPS claim form.
  • Proof of value for the lost or damaged items, such as receipts or invoices.
  • Photographic evidence of any damage, if applicable.
  • Any relevant shipping documents, including the original shipping label.

Having these documents ready can expedite the claims process and increase the likelihood of a successful resolution.

Form Submission Methods

The UPS claim form can be submitted through various methods, allowing for flexibility based on your preferences:

  • Online Submission: The most efficient method is to complete the form online through the UPS website. This allows for immediate processing.
  • Mail Submission: If you prefer to submit a physical copy, you can print the completed form and mail it to the designated UPS claims department.
  • In-Person Submission: For those who wish to speak directly with a UPS representative, visiting a local UPS store may be an option for submitting your claim.

Eligibility Criteria for Filing a Claim

To qualify for a claim with UPS, certain eligibility criteria must be met. These include:

  • The shipment must have been sent using a UPS service that offers coverage for loss or damage.
  • The claim must be filed within the specified time frame, typically within sixty days of the delivery date.
  • The value of the items must be declared at the time of shipping, and proof of value must be provided.

Understanding these criteria can help ensure that your claim is valid and processed efficiently.
